移動(dòng)端CSS圖片變顏色怎么辦
在移動(dòng)端開發(fā)中,我們經(jīng)常會(huì)遇到需要將圖片顏色進(jìn)行調(diào)整的情況,雖然HTML和CSS提供了豐富的工具來實(shí)現(xiàn)這一功能,但如何在移動(dòng)端***地改變圖片顏色仍然是一個(gè)挑戰(zhàn),下面是一些建議和實(shí)踐,幫助你解決移動(dòng)端CSS圖片變顏色的問題。
1、使用CSS濾鏡:CSS濾鏡是一種方便的工具,可以用來調(diào)整圖片的顏色,常見的濾鏡包括brightness
(亮度)、contrast
(對(duì)比度)、saturation
(飽和度)和color
(顏色),你可以使用filter: saturate(2)
來增加圖片的飽和度,或者使用filter: color(red)
來將圖片的顏色調(diào)整為紅色。
2、轉(zhuǎn)換圖片格式:將圖片轉(zhuǎn)換為不同的格式也可以改變其顏色,將圖片從RGB轉(zhuǎn)換為CMYK可以顯著改變其顏色表現(xiàn),這種方法可能需要專業(yè)的圖像處理軟件或工具來實(shí)現(xiàn)。
3、使用JavaScript庫(kù):有一些JavaScript庫(kù)可以幫助你在移動(dòng)端***地調(diào)整圖片顏色。fabric.js
和pixi.js
都提供了豐富的API來操作圖片和顏色,這些庫(kù)通常比純CSS方法更強(qiáng)大,但也需要更多的學(xué)習(xí)和配置。
移動(dòng)端CSS圖片變顏色是一個(gè)需要綜合考慮多種因素的問題,通過結(jié)合CSS濾鏡、圖片格式轉(zhuǎn)換和JavaScript庫(kù)等方法,你可以找到***適合你的解決方案,在實(shí)際開發(fā)中多嘗試和調(diào)整,以達(dá)到***佳的效果。